Natural ways to support cognitive clarity as you age

As we age, many people become increasingly aware of the importance of maintaining cognitive clarity. This refers to the ability to think clearly, process information, and make sound decisions. Fortunately, there are several natural ways to support cognitive function as we get older. By adopting a holistic approach that includes a balanced diet, regular exercise, mental challenges, and lifestyle adjustments, you can promote cognitive health long into your senior years.

One of the most crucial factors in supporting cognitive clarity is nutrition. The brain requires a variety of nutrients to function optimally. Incorporating foods rich in antioxidants, healthy fats, vitamins, and minerals can help fend off cognitive decline. Foods like fatty fish (rich in omega-3 fatty acids), berries, leafy greens, and nuts have been shown to enhance brain health. Omega-3 fatty acids, in particular, are essential for maintaining neuronal function and can improve memory and mood. Additionally, incorporating foods high in antioxidants, like blueberries and spinach, can help combat oxidative stress, which is detrimental to brain cells.

Hydration plays a significant role in maintaining cognitive clarity as well. Dehydration can lead to difficulties in concentration, confusion, and cognitive fatigue. Ensuring you drink enough water and stay hydrated throughout your day can help maintain cognitive function. Herbal teas and fruits can also contribute to hydration while providing added health benefits.

Regular physical exercise is another key component in promoting cognitive clarity. Engaging in activities that increase your heart rate can stimulate blood flow to the brain, encouraging the growth of new brain cells. Studies have shown that aerobic exercises, such as walking, swimming, or cycling, can enhance cognitive abilities and reduce the risk of cognitive decline. Furthermore, strength training is also beneficial; it not only improves physical health but can also contribute to improved cognitive function through various biological mechanisms, including the release of neurotrophic factors that aid brain health.

Mental stimulation is essential for brain health and clarity as you age. Engaging in puzzles, playing musical instruments, or learning a new language can stimulate different areas of the brain and improve cognitive flexibility. Social interactions also play a crucial role in mental engagement. Staying socially active can help prevent feelings of isolation and depression, both of which can adversely affect cognitive function.

Getting adequate sleep is vital as well. Sleep disturbances can severely impact cognition, leading to memory issues and impaired decision-making. Establishing a regular sleep routine by going to bed and waking up at the same time each day can greatly improve the quality of sleep. Creating a restful environment and avoiding screens before bedtime can enhance the ability to fall asleep and stay asleep throughout the night.

Lastly, practices such as mindfulness and stress management can offer significant benefits for cognitive clarity. Chronic stress has a damaging effect on the brain, particularly on memory and executive functions. Techniques such as meditation, yoga, and deep-breathing exercises can help manage stress levels. Incorporating these practices into your daily routine may protect your brain health and promote a clear, focused mind.
